Fondazione Prada/Bar Luce
Anyone in Milan should definitely not miss Bar Luce. The new glossy sixties café, designed by none other than director and actor Wes Anderson, can be found in Fondazione Prada, a complex for modern art and culture. A feast for the eyes. The dishes, from pancakes to cakes, from the café-restaurant are quite expensive, but just a cup of coffee (and a stroll around) is fine: you won't be the only one. Or just sneak to the toilet, even that is crazy. Read more: Bar Luce

Orsonero Coffee
This Scandinavian-looking coffee shop has only just opened and is already the favorite of many. The family business (when in Italy...) serves special coffees in the Porta Venezia district. The family likes an experiment from time to time and therefore changes the menu regularly, reason enough to come back regularly. Tea is also available, as are freshly baked rolls, pastries and cookies. Via Broggi 15Orsonero Coffee

Giacomo Caffe
We've said it before and will say it again here: there is little to nothing better than a good (art deco) classic. If you're near the Duomo (and you will be at some point), pop into the Giacomo Caffee at Palazzo Reale. That's one of those a blast from the past. The literary café is perfect for a coffee, but dining is also possible. Moreover, there is plenty to do for vegetarians. Dome square 12Giacomo Caffe

Canteen Milano
It's a bit crazy, going to a Mexican when you're the foodie country on earth... But hey, you can just fancy tequila and tacos, right? And then you go to Canteen Milano where exactly that is served at a spacious, colorful bar and in a fantastic courtyard. If you want to go, keep in mind that you can't have everything: the courtyard is great, the vibes are happy but not the tacos best ever (because Italians) and as soon as possible, the music gets louder and there is dancing and banter (because Italians). Via Archimedes 10, Canteen Milano
